Job Title: Steel Fixer Location: Market Bosworth Pay: £24 P/H (We don\’t use any umbrella companies) Hours of Work: 9 hours Type: Site Based Start Date: Immediately We are hiring for a Steel Fixer for 2 weeks worth of work in the Cadeby area for one of our clients. Duties of a Steel Fixer: • Installing and fixing steel reinforcement bars (rebar) according to project specifications • Reading and interpreting construction drawings and blueprints • Ensuring steel reinforcement is securely tied and positioned for concrete placement • Working safely and efficiently while adhering to health and safety regulations Skills and experience of a Steel Erector: • Proven experience as a steel fixer or similar role in construction • Strong knowledge of steel fixing techniques and reinforcement practices • Ability to read and understand construction drawings • Physically fit and able to work in outdoor, sometimes challenging conditions • CSCS card • Own tools and PPE • Strong communication skills and ability to work in a team environment About the Client Our client is a civil and groundworks contractor based in the Leicester area.
